Howe blessyd Radegunde delyuered a woman possessyd with a fynde/from daunger and payne/to helth and prosperite.

A certayne woman dwelled by the monastery
Whiche was possessyd/with a spirite infernall
By long contynuaunce enduryng misery
Sore vexed/and greued/with paynes thrall
Tearyng with violence/as a beest brutall
Man/woman/and childe/with great cruelte
In a hiduous rage/alas the more pite
Thus she possessyd suffred mycle payne
The mynde sore moued/alienat from reason
The profet of her soule/forgetyng certayne
To charitable werkes/had no entencion
Frewyll was tollyd so was deuocion


She had no power to say nor do truly
But as the sayd fende put in her memory
She was strayte bounde/bothe fote and hande
For drede of myschefe/and wickydnesse
Her frendes dwellyng within the lande
Were woful in hert/no meruell doutlesse
Consideryng theyr kynswoman/in suche distresse
With wepyng waylyng/they came mekely
Besekyng mayde Radegunde/for helpe and remedy
O cumly creature/and kynges doughter dere
O vertuous lady/moniall and abbasse
We call to the knelyng afore the here
Have pyte and compassyon/in this exstreme case
Be thou our succour/comfort and solace
Helpe this wofull wreche/humble we the pray
By thy prayer and myght as thou well may
Unto whose prayer peticyon and desyre
Saynt Radegunde/was moued to compassyon
Commaundyng them all/with loue entyre
To bryng the sayd woman/and wofull person
Unto her presence/hastely and soone
Her frendes were glad/and made good chere
Ioyfull to fulfyll the commaundement in fere
Whan they aproched/to this wofull pacient
Redy to conuey her/to the holy place
The sayd wickyd sporyte/moued her entent
Euer to the contrary/by power and manace
She rayled/and raged/and spyt in theyr face

At the last by power/wysdome and myght
This woman was brought/before this lady bryght
On whom she had compassion/and pety
And anone commaunded/in presence of them all
That wycked sprite/and mortall enemy
To cease of his greuaunce/and paynes thrall
And shortly to the grounde/before her to fall
Also to departe this sayd woman fro
Neuer more to vex her with payne nor wo
Anone the sprite obeyed/the commaundement
Myght no lenger tary/day nor yet houre
Immediatly departed/from the feble pacient
With an hydeous cry full of great doloure
The woman rose vp out of her langour
And kneled downe/thankyng god almyght
And blessed Radegunde of this myracle ryght.
